在当今数字化时代,企业应用程序的响应速度对于用户体验和业务成功至关重要。成都阿里云作为领先的云计算服务提供商,为众多企业和开发者提供了强大的计算资源。在实际应用中,我们经常会遇到响应时间过长的问题。为了帮助大家更好地利用成都阿里云服务器,并实现应用性能的优化,本文将分享一些有效的性能调优技巧。
1. 选择合适的实例类型
根据您的工作负载需求选择适当的实例规格是至关重要的。成都阿里云提供了多种不同的实例类型,包括通用型、计算密集型、内存优化型等。确保您选择了与应用程序特点相匹配的实例类型,可以避免因资源不足或过剩而导致的性能问题。
2. 合理配置磁盘IO
磁盘读写操作往往是影响应用响应时间的关键因素之一。通过使用高效能存储介质(如SSD),并调整文件系统参数来提高磁盘I/O性能;另外还可以采用分布式存储方案或者缓存技术减少对磁盘频繁访问的需求。
3. 优化网络设置
良好的网络连接质量也是保证快速响应不可或缺的部分。建议您尽量选择靠近目标用户的地域部署服务器,并开启BGP多线接入以降低延迟。合理规划VPC网络架构、优化路由策略同样有助于改善整体网络性能。
4. 调整数据库参数
对于依赖数据库的应用程序而言,正确设置数据库相关参数能够显著提升查询效率。例如,适当增加缓冲池大小可以让更多数据驻留在内存中从而加快检索速度;而限制并发连接数则可防止过多请求导致系统过载。
5. 利用弹性伸缩功能
当业务高峰期到来时,自动扩展计算资源可以帮助应对突然增加的流量压力。成都阿里云提供的弹性伸缩服务可以根据预设规则动态调整实例数量,在保障服务质量的同时降低成本支出。
6. 应用层面上的优化
除了上述硬件层面的措施外,从代码编写角度出发进行针对性改进也不容忽视。比如采用异步编程模型减少阻塞等待时间;精简不必要的逻辑判断以减轻CPU负担;以及借助内容分发网络(CDN)加速静态资源加载等等。
通过对成都阿里云服务器进行全面细致地分析评估,并结合以上提到的各种性能调优方法,相信您可以有效缩短应用程序响应时间,为用户提供更加流畅便捷的服务体验。具体实施过程中还需要结合实际情况灵活运用这些技巧,不断测试验证效果直至达到最佳状态。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/60897.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。